Overview

Job Description

About us: Join a trusted leader in Animal Health where science, quality and care come together to support healthier animals and stronger communities. We’re looking for a hands‑on, proactive Plant Engineer to lead maintenance and engineering activities across two UK production sites. If you thrive in a regulated manufacturing environment, enjoy solving technical challenges and coaching teams, this role offers variety, responsibility and real impact.

Responsibilities
  • Lead and manage the Primary and Secondary Manufacturing maintenance teams.
  • Own and maintain the maintenance master plan, aligning activities with the production schedule.
  • Ensure strict adherence to current Good Manufacturing Practice (cGMP) and good documentation practice.
  • Schedule and supervise external vendors and on‑site engineering contractors.
  • Maintain and improve Safety, Health & Environment (SHE) systems, actively participating to ensure compliance.
  • Plan, coordinate and manage maintenance and validation shutdowns.
  • Identify, lead and participate in continuous improvement initiatives with cross‑functional teams.
  • Provide on‑the‑floor technical support to Production during root‑cause investigations and improvement projects.
  • Support the delivery of maintenance group projects locally.
  • Represent the maintenance function during internal and external quality and SHE audits.
What you’ll bring
Qualifications
  • Higher National Certificate or Bachelor’s degree in an engineering discipline (or equivalent experience).
Experience
  • Engineering experience within the pharmaceutical manufacturing sector.
  • Practical experience maintaining equipment and systems common to pharmaceutical production, including but not limited to: HVAC, purified water and pure steam systems, autoclaves, refrigeration, pressure and process vessels, pipework and sterile components, utilities (steam, compressed air, nitrogen), electrical switchgear and controls, PLCs, SCADA and building management systems.
  • Understanding of cGMP and strong documentation practices.
  • Experience managing external contractors and using computerized maintenance management systems (CMMS).
  • Confident user of standard PC applications, particularly Microsoft Word, Excel and Project.
Skills and attributes
  • Highly organised, with excellent planning and prioritisation skills.
  • Strong collaborative team player who can build relationships across functions.
  • Clear and effective verbal and written communication.
  • High integrity, credibility and energy.
  • Sound decision‑making and analytical skills; able to evaluate issues from multiple perspectives and deliver timely, well‑reasoned conclusions.
  • Coachable and able to influence change through mentoring and motivation.
  • Proactive problem solver with a track record of driving improvements through to closure.
